使用Python向列表中添加元素的方法
更新时间:2023-07-15Python中添加元素的方法
Python中的列表是一种有序的数据类型,可以包含不同类型的数据。向列表中添加元素是非常常见的操作。Python提供了几种方法来向列表中添加元素。
使用append()方法向列表末尾添加元素
append()方法可以将一个元素添加到列表的末尾。以下示例展示了如何使用append()方法向列表中添加一个元素:
# 创建一个空列表 my_list = [] # 向列表中添加元素 my_list.append(1) print(my_list) # 输出[1]
使用insert()方法向列表指定位置添加元素
insert()方法可以将一个元素添加到列表的指定位置。以下示例展示了如何使用insert()方法向列表中指定位置添加一个元素:
# 创建一个列表 my_list = [1, 2, 3] # 向列表中指定位置添加元素 my_list.insert(1, 4) print(my_list) # 输出[1, 4, 2, 3]
使用extend()方法向列表末尾添加多个元素
extend()方法可以将一个列表的所有元素添加到另一个列表的末尾。以下示例展示了如何使用extend()方法向列表中添加多个元素:
# 创建一个列表 my_list = [1, 2, 3] # 向列表中添加多个元素 my_list.extend([4, 5]) print(my_list) # 输出[1, 2, 3, 4, 5]
使用"+"运算符向列表中添加多个元素
"+"运算符也可以用来向列表中添加多个元素。该运算符会将两个列表连接成一个新的列表。以下示例展示了如何使用"+"运算符向列表中添加多个元素:
# 创建两个列表 my_list1 = [1, 2] my_list2 = [3, 4] # 向列表中添加多个元素 my_list3 = my_list1 + my_list2 print(my_list3) # 输出[1, 2, 3, 4]总结:Python提供了多种方法向列表中添加元素,其中包括append()、insert()、extend()和"+"运算符。选择哪种方法取决于具体的需求。如果只需要向列表末尾添加一个元素,应该使用append()方法;如果需要向列表中指定位置添加元素,应该使用insert()方法;如果需要向列表末尾添加多个元素,应该使用extend()方法或"+"运算符。